I’ve been a fan of The Hobbit and The Lord of the Rings since I was very small. My dad is a huge fan of J.R.R. Tolkien, to the point that he actually wore out his hard cover copies of the trilogy. So one of my favorite memories is sitting on the edge of my dad’s chair as he read these wonderful stories to me.

When The Lord of the Rings came out, I saw each of the movies several times in the theater. It would get to the point that I wouldn’t have anyone to go with and would have to see them by myself. So, I’ve been following the progress of the films that will bring The Hobbit to the big screen.

The long wait has been worth it as the first teaser trailer was released tonight. The movie looks fantastic, but you can see for yourself below. The first poster has been also released tonight. Both of these things are making me so excited for this movie to come out. For all the fans of The Hobbit, it is going to be a long year until we get to see this book come to life. But at least we now have a trailer that we can watch as we wait.
